Job Title: Warehouse / Forklift Driver Job Description This role supports a busy stockroom and warehouse by accurately pulling orders, handling materials, performing inventory checks, and using scan guns and computers to track inventory. You will operate forklifts, climb ladders, and bend to pick parts, while occasionally interacting with customers to pull their orders and load their vehicles with the parts they have purchased.

Responsibilities Pull and prepare customer orders from the stockroom and warehouse using scan guns and RF scanners. Load and unload materials, parts, and products from trucks and customer vehicles in a safe and efficient manner. Perform material handling tasks, including organizing, staging, and moving inventory throughout the warehouse. Conduct regular inventory checks and use computers to track stock levels, locations, and order status.

Operate forklifts to move pallets and materials, following all safety procedures and guidelines. Climb ladders, bend, and reach to pick items from shelves and racks as needed. Use RF scanners and scan guns to accurately scan, record, and update inventory and order information. Provide courteous customer service when interacting with customers to pull their orders and load their vehicles. Maintain a clean, organized, and safe warehouse environment, including work areas, aisles, and storage locations.

Follow all warehouse procedures for order picking, order pulling, loading, and unloading. Collaborate with warehouse team members to ensure efficient workflow and timely completion of orders. Work Environment This position is based in a small distribution facility that supplies plumbing and piping products, with approximately 10 people working in the warehouse. The schedule runs Monday through Friday, with an 8-hour shift between 8:00 a.m. and 5:00 p.m., and occasional overtime, typically during the summer.

You will work both inside the warehouse and outside in the yard, and you will be exposed to natural elements when loading and unloading trucks and customer vehicles. The environment is hands-on and physically active, with regular use of forklifts, RF scanners, scan guns, and computers to manage inventory
